Welcome to Kensington ...



The town of Kensington was established in 1824.

Kensington is 80 feet [24 m] above sea level.<1>.

Time Zone: Kensington lies in the Atlantic Time Zone (AST/ADT) and observes daylight saving time. The time zone in French: AST- Heure Normale de l'Atlantique (HNA), ADT- Heure Avancée de l'Atlantique (HAA).

The area code for Kensington: (902)

The Canadian Postal Code for Kensington: C0B<2>

<2>The Canadian Postal Code consists of 6 characters, where the first three characters are the 'Forward Sortation Area (FSA)', with the last three characters being the 'Local Delivery Unit (LDU)'. The Canadian Postal Codes were created as a way of grouping addresses to make delivery more efficient. So keep in mind that any given Postal Code is only 'loosely' associated with a community (such as Kensington). The boundaries of the Postal Code can be changed, re-assigned, eliminated or overlapped with other Postal Codes. When looking for a Postal Code, whether Kensington or elsewhere, it's always best to check the website of the Canada Post / Postes Canada.
